


Join us February 5-7, 2024 for in-person training at MTEC in Mooresville, NC on Drilling presented by Peter Dunster and Brian Jewell. This course will cover short hole drilling, deep hole drilling, solid carbide drills, indexable drills, boring holes, helical interpolation of holes, and thread milling. There will be demonstrations of each.
